MINNEAPOLIS -- For the second week in a row, Gophers punter
Peter Mortell was honored as the Big Ten Special Teams Player of the Week.
Mortell punted four times in Saturday’s 24-10 victory over
visiting Penn State and averaged 46.0 yards per punt. One of Mortell’s punts
was downed at the 1-yard line, while another was downed at the 2-yard line to
help the Gophers win the field-position battle. After Saturday’s game, Mortell
is now tied for second in the Big Ten in yards per punt this season (42.8).
It marks the second straight week in which Mortell won the
award. He also was honored after last week’s win at Indiana, in which he
averaged 43.0 yards per punt, with two of them downed inside the 20-yard line.
